日期:2014-05-17  浏览次数:20548 次

行列转化 弱弱的问一下


1111 aa
1111 bb
2222 cc
2222 dd
转化为
1111 aa,bb
2222 cc,dd

------解决方案--------------------
这不是行转列,这是字符串的拼接。

SQL code

select col1,
    stuff((select ','+col2 from tb where col1 = t.col1 for xml path('')),1,1,'') as col2
from tb t
group by col1

--sql2005  try !